The Growing Demand for Niche Marketing

The term "niche marketing" refers to the practice of targeting a specific subset of consumers within a larger market. By focusing on a particular segment, businesses can create content, products, and services that resonate deeply with their audience. The benefits of niche marketing are numerous: higher conversion rates, increased brand loyalty, and a competitive edge in the market.

Niche marketing is on the rise due to the proliferation of social media and online platforms. With the rise of Instagram, TikTok, and other visual-centric platforms, consumers are craving unique and personalized content that speaks directly to their interests and values.

Understanding the Mechanics of Niche Marketing

At its core, niche marketing involves researching and identifying a specific target audience. This requires a deep understanding of consumer behavior, demographics, and psychographics. By gathering data on your target audience’s preferences, interests, and pain points, you can tailor your marketing strategy to meet their needs.

Effective niche marketing involves creating content that resonates with your target audience. This can be achieved through various channels, including social media, email marketing, and content creation. By speaking directly to your audience, you can build trust, establish brand loyalty, and drive conversions.

Niche Marketing Strategies for Different User Types

One of the most significant advantages of niche marketing is its versatility. Depending on your business goals and target audience, you can implement various strategies to capitalize on the niche marketing trend. Here are a few examples:

  • Local businesses: Catering to a specific geographic location can help you tap into local trends and interests. By creating content that speaks to the concerns and values of your local audience, you can establish a strong presence in your community.
  • E-commerce entrepreneurs: For online businesses, niche marketing involves identifying specific product niches and catering to customers with unique interests. By focusing on a specific product niche, you can build a loyal customer base and drive sales.
  • Service providers: Niche marketing can also be applied to service-based businesses, such as consulting, coaching, or healthcare. By identifying specific pain points and interests within your target audience, you can create targeted marketing campaigns and build a loyal client base.

Niche Marketing Opportunities and Challenges

As with any marketing strategy, niche marketing presents both opportunities and challenges. Here are a few key benefits and drawbacks:

  • Benefits:
    • Increased conversion rates
    • Higher brand loyalty
    • Competitive edge in the market
  • Drawbacks:
    • Requires extensive research and data analysis
    • Can be challenging to scale or expand the niche
    • Requires continuous adaptation to changing trends and consumer preferences
